Unlocking the Microbial World: The Role of Metagenomics and AI
Recent advancements in DNA sequencing have broadened our understanding of microbes, yet the challenge of cultivating most of them remains significant. A new predictive framework may offer solutions.
The field of metagenomics, combined with artificial intelligence, is poised to enhance our understanding of uncultivated bacteria and archaea. Despite advances in DNA sequencing technology, cultivating the vast majority of these microorganisms has proven difficult.
Researchers are now exploring a systematic, predictive framework that integrates existing genomic data with computational models. This approach aims to bridge the gap between genomic insights and practical cultivation techniques.
As scientists continue to unravel the complexities of the microbial world, the potential applications of these findings could be transformative for various fields, including medicine and environmental science.
